Rechargeable battery notice
Do not attempt to disassemble or modify the battery pack. Attempting to do so
can cause an explosion, or liquid leakage from the battery pack. A battery pack
other than the one specified by Lenovo, or a disassembled or modified battery
pack is not covered by the warranty.
If the rechargeable battery pack is incorrectly replaced, there is danger of an
explosion. The battery pack contains a small amount of harmful substances.
To avoid possible injury:
• Replace only with a battery of the type recommended by Lenovo.
• Keep the battery pack away from fire.
• Do not expose it to water or rain.
• Do not attempt to disassemble it.
• Do not short-circuit it.
• Keep it away from children.
• Do not drop the battery pack.
Do not put the battery pack in trash that is disposed of in landfills. When
disposing of the battery, comply with local ordinances or regulations.

Using headphones or earphones
If your computer has both a headphone connector and an audio-out connector, always
use the headphone connector for headphones (also called a headset) or earphones.
Excessive sound pressure from earphones and headphones can cause hearing loss.
Adjustment of the equalizer to maximum increases the earphones and headphones
output voltage and therefore the sound pressure level.
Excessive use of headphones or earphones for a long period of time at high volume
can be dangerous if the output of the headphones or earphone connectors do not
comply with specifications of EN 50332-2. The headphone output connector of your
computer complies with EN 50332-2 Sub clause 7.
This specification limits the computer's maximum wide band true RMS output
voltage to 150 mV. To help protect against hearing loss, ensure that the headphones
or earphones you use also comply with EN 50332-2 (Clause 7 limits) for a wide
band characteristic voltage of 75 mV. Using headphones that do not comply with
EN 50332-2 can be dangerous due to excessive sound pressure levels.
If your Lenovo computer came with headphones or earphones in the package,
as a set, combination of the headphones or earphones and the computer already
complies with the specifications of EN 50332-1. If different headphones or
earphones are used, ensure that they comply with EN 50332-1 (Clause 6.5
Limitation Values). Using headphones that do not comply with EN 50332-1 can be
dangerous due to excessive sound pressure levels.

How to obtain warranty service
If the product does not function as warranted during the warranty period, you
may obtain warranty service by contacting Lenovo or a Lenovo approved Service
Provider. A list of approved Service Providers and their telephone numbers is
available at: http://www.lenovo.com/support/phone.

If you obtain service under this warranty, you authorize Lenovo to store, use and
process information about your warranty service and your contact information,
including name, phone numbers, address, and e-mail address. Lenovo may use
this information to perform service under this warranty. We may contact you to
inquire about your satisfaction with our warranty service or to notify you about
any product recalls or safety issues. In accomplishing these purposes, you authorize
Lenovo to transfer your information to any country where we do business and to
provide it to entities acting on our behalf. We may also disclose it where required
by law. Lenovo’s privacy policy is available at http://www.lenovo.com/.

What your service provider will do to correct problems
When you contact a Service Provider, you must follow the specified problem
determination and resolution procedures.
The Service Provider will attempt to diagnose and resolve your problem by
telephone, e-mail or remote assistance. The Service Provider may direct you to
download and install designated software updates.
Some problems may be resolved with a replacement part that you install yourself
called a “Customer Replaceable Unit” or “CRU”. If so, the Service Provider will
ship the CRU to you for you to install.
If your problem cannot be resolved over the telephone; through the application of
software updates or the installation of a CRU, the Service Provider will arrange for
service under the type of warranty service designated for the product under
“Part 3 - Warranty service information” below.
If the Service Provider determines that it is unable to repair your product, the
Service Provider will replace it with one that is at least functionally equivalent.

Neither Lenovo nor the Service Provider is responsible for loss or disclosure of
any data, including confidential information, proprietary information, or personal
information, contained in a product.

Dispute resolution
Disputes arising out of or in connection with this warranty shall be finally settled
by arbitration held in Singapore. This warranty shall be governed, construed and
enforced in accordance with the laws of Singapore, without regard to conflict of laws.
If you acquired the product in India, disputes arising out of or in connection with this
warranty shall be finally settled by arbitration held in Bangalore, India. Arbitration
in Singapore shall be held in accordance with the Arbitration Rules of Singapore
International Arbitration Center (“SIAC Rules”) then in effect. Arbitration in India
shall be held in accordance with the laws of India then in effect. The arbitration
award shall be final and binding on the parties without appeal. Any award shall be
in writing and set forth the findings of fact and the conclusions of law. All arbitration
proceedings, including all documents presented in such proceedings shall be
conducted in the English language. The English language version of this warranty
prevails over any other language version in such proceedings.

Collecting and recycling a disused Lenovo computer or monitor
If you are a company employee and need to dispose of a Lenovo computer or
monitor that is the property of the company, you must do so in accordance with the
Law for Promotion of Effective Utilization of Resources. Computers and monitors
are categorized as industrial waste and should be properly disposed of by an
industrial waste disposal contractor certified by a local government. In accordance
with the Law for Promotion of Effective Utilization of Resources, Lenovo Japan
provides, through its PC Collecting and Recycling Services, for the collecting, reuse,
and recycling of disused computers and monitors. For details, go to:
http://www.lenovo.com/recycling/japan
Pursuant to the Law for Promotion of Effective Utilization of Resources, the
collecting and recycling of home-used computers and monitors by the manufacturer
was begun on October 1, 2003. This service is provided free of charge for homeused computers sold after October 1, 2003. For details, go to:
http://www.lenovo.com/recycling/japan

Batteries and electrical and electronic equipment
marked with the symbol of a crossed-out wheeled
bin may not be disposed as unsorted municipal
waste. Batteries and waste of electrical and
electronic equipment (WEEE) shall be treated
separately using the collection framework
available to customers for the return, recycling,
and treatment of batteries and WEEE. When
possible, remove and isolate batteries from
WEEE prior to placing WEEE in the waste
collection stream. Batteries are to be collected
separately using the framework available for the
return, recycling, and treatment of batteries and
accumulators.
